When Darren Holme wakes from a five-year coma, the world feels alien, yet strangely familiar. A successful businessman with ties to military innovations, Darren remembers everything-except the eight months leading up to the accident that left him unconscious. Those months, along with the life he should have lived since, are a void.
The more Darren tries to reintegrate, the more cracks begin to show. Shadows of memories tease him-fragments of conversations, fleeting moments of betrayal. Were the events that led to his coma truly an accident? Or was there a darker conspiracy aimed at silencing him?
With his instincts as his only guide, Darren begins to uncover the truth, piece by piece. But as he gets closer to the answers, he realises that some secrets are buried for a reason-and unearthing them might cost him more than he ever imagined.
From the award winning author of The Ribbon Tree comes Broken Holme, a gripping tale of memory, trust, and the relentless pursuit of truth in a world where nothing is as it seems.
